Can Anyone Remember What Student Arrest Was Like Before Tasers?

don't tase me.png

After Andrew Meyer was arrested Monday and repeatedly Tased by police after verbally niggling John Kerry, his cry of “Don’t tase me, bro!” has sparked an online phenomenon all its own.

Even YTMND got in on it: donttasemebro.ytmnd.com.

Vox notes that while the quote’s been appropriated with a light-hearted veneer, it’s being used as a tool to spark tense discussions about the ethics of cops, Tasers and unruly suburban university kids. Can’t we all just get along?
